Scuba tank bottom protectors are a simple but essential accessory designed to shield the base of your tank from the inevitable bumps, scrapes, and abrasions that come with frequent use. These protectors serve as a buffer between the hard metal of your tank and rough surfaces, helping to prevent dings, paint chipping, and corrosion that can compromise the integrity of your gear. For divers who store their tanks upright in garages, dive lockers, or on boat decks, a tank bottom protector can mean the difference between a pristine tank and one that’s marred by rust or deep scratches. Those who regularly transport their gear in cars or dive vans also appreciate how these protectors minimize the risk of tanks rolling and clanking against each other, keeping both the tanks and the vehicle interiors in better shape.
Choosing the right scuba tank bottom protector depends on your diving habits and the environments you frequent. If you often dive from shorelines with rocky entries or spend time on boats with metal decks, a durable, snug-fitting protector is invaluable. Many divers prefer protectors made from tough, non-slip materials that provide extra grip, reducing the chance of tanks slipping on wet surfaces. Some protectors are designed to be easily removed for cleaning, while others offer a more permanent fit, ideal for those who want a set-it-and-forget-it solution. For instructors, dive shop staff, or anyone managing multiple tanks during busy seasons, color-coded protectors can also help with organization and quick identification.
